Abstract
Nowadays, accessing open data is a difficult task since current Open Data platforms do not generally provide suitable strategies to access their data. Moreover, Linked Open Data requires knowledge in different technologies, which is a challenging task especially for novice developers. In order to manage this open data, Web APIs with accurate documentation are highly recommended features that not all platforms include. Providing these APIs would help developers to easily access data, but this access is still limited for end-users, particularly those with disabilities. Therefore, there is a gap between open data and users in which our APIfication approach can help by creating APIs for available datasets. It consists of a model-based generation of suitable APIs with natural language documentation to access open data, a universal API to access linked open data easily and a Web augmentation framework to improve data accessibility, helping users with disabilities. Accordingly, the aim of this PhD is to provide suitable mechanisms to easily access and reuse open data.
